Meaning
Cut-proof gloves are personal protective equipment (PPE) designed to protect hands from cuts, slashes, and punctures. They are made from advanced materials such as high-performance fibers, stainless steel mesh, and synthetic blends, providing a barrier against sharp objects and machinery in industrial and commercial settings.

Category-wise Insights
- Kevlar Gloves: Kevlar gloves are popular for their exceptional cut resistance, durability, and flexibility, making them ideal for industries such as manufacturing, construction, and automotive where workers are exposed to sharp tools, machinery, and materials. Kevlar gloves offer superior protection against cuts and abrasions while maintaining dexterity and tactile sensitivity for precision tasks.
- Dyneema Gloves: Dyneema gloves are known for their high strength-to-weight ratio, cut resistance, and lightweight design, providing users with comfortable and breathable hand protection in demanding work environments. Dyneema gloves are widely used in industries such as food processing, glass handling, and metal fabrication where workers require dexterity, grip, and protection against sharp objects and edges.
- Stainless Steel Mesh Gloves: Stainless steel mesh gloves offer puncture resistance and cut protection for workers handling sharp knives, blades, and cutting tools in the food processing and culinary industries. These gloves feature interlocking stainless steel rings that form a flexible and durable barrier against cuts, slashes, and abrasions while allowing for airflow and moisture management to reduce hand fatigue and discomfort during prolonged use.
